Salzgitter Flachstahl signs deal with Energiekontor for green electricity

Steel manufacturer Salzgitter Flachstahl has signed a major deal with German energy company Energiekontor to source green electricity from two new solar parks, as part of its commitment to sustainability goals.

Salzgitter Flachstahl signs deal with Energiekontor for green electricity

The agreement will see Energiekontor supply Salzgitter Flachstahl with electricity from the two solar parks, which are being built in Mecklenburg-Vorpommern. The parks, with a total capacity of 113 MW, are scheduled to be operational by mid-2026 and will provide over 120 GWh of green electricity per year to Salzgitter Flachstahl.

The 15-year Power Purchase Agreements (PPAs) represent a long-term partnership between the two companies as they both transition towards a sustainable energy future.

"These agreements are a major step for our company in achieving our green energy goals and diversifying our suppliers," said Ralf Schaper, Head of Energy Management at Salzgitter Flachstahl.

Energiekontor, a leading developer and operator of wind and solar energy projects in Germany, is reaffirming its commitment to providing sustainable energy solutions with this agreement.
